People Editorial Guidelines Published on October 4, 2015 08:35 PM Share Tweet Pin Email Caleb Logan Bratayley, one of the stars of the popular YouTube family known as the Bratayleys, has died. He was 13. Caleb’s mother, Katie, announced the news in an Instagram post on Friday. “[Thursday] at 7:08PM Caleb Logan Bratayley passed away of natural causes,” she wrote. “This has come as a shock to all of us. Words cannot describe how much we will miss him. “His incredibly funny, loving and wonderful spirit made us all fall in love with him as a YouTuber, friend, brother and son,” she continued. “We know you tune in to watch each day and eagerly anticipate new videos, but ask that you bear with us while we deal with this tragedy as a family. Please help us honor our, baked potato.” Maker Studios, the Walt Disney-owned digital company that counted the Bratayleys as one of its acts confirmed Caleb’s death in a statement on Instagram. “We are heartbroken at the tragic loss of Caleb from Bratayley, a beloved member of the Maker family,” the company wrote. “Our love, support, thoughts, and prayers are with the Bratayley family.” On Saturday, one day after the family shared the news, they posted one of their daily vlogging videos which included Caleb. According the video, it was made on Wednesday, one day before the teen died. “It is with our deepest sorrow to report that the Instagram announcement was indeed true,” the Bratayleys wrote on YouTube. “In addition to our desire to give the Internet community the chance to begin the grieving process, we also wanted to post this video to show a healthy and happy Caleb doing what he loved. Thank you for all the love and support that everyone has shown our family. And we ask for continued love and support as we move through the grieving process.” In the video, Caleb is seen talking about what he would ask his “future self” if he was given one question. After a long pause, Caleb jokingly asks, “Is Taco Bell still around?” He later said he would ask if there were “any new sports” in the future. On Sunday, the family shared a montage video of Caleb’s best moments from over their five years of vlogging. While the family – whose real name is not Bratayley – has maintained that the teen died of “natural causes,” the ambiguity of the statement and Caleb’s healthy-looking appearance in their last video is causing fans to question the reason for his death. In their videos and social media posts, the Bratayleys have asked for privacy while the grieve and have not gone into specifics about Caleb’s death. It’s unclear if the Bratayleys will continue vlogging following Caleb’s death.
